Job description

Under the supervision of Chief and/or Assistant Chief Engineer, the HVAC Mechanic performs functions and duties that do not require the expertise of a Stationary Engineer. 
 
Supports the implementation and documentation of site safety plans and all ABM Engineering Services' operational standards and guidelines as well as site specific standards, policies and procedures relating to the engineering department.
 
Preferred candidate is proficient and experienced in diagnosis and troubleshooting of HVAC electrical control systems, motors and components. Preferred experience in repairs/replacement of compressors, TXVs, refrigerant lines and the reclamation of refrigerant.
REPRESENTATIVE FUNCTIONS OR DUTIES:
  • Maintains and cleans mechanical, electrical and shop areas.
  • Coordinates parts, supplies, and equipment from local vendors and inventory.
  • Performs simple procedures and tasks and other routine maintenance duties.
  • Performs miscellaneous tasks as assigned by the Chief Engineer and Assistant Chief Engineer.
  • Fosters a work environment that promotes energy conservation and continuous improvement of engineering functions.
  • As appropriate, records all pertinent data in building logbooks and makes all appropriate daily entries.
  • Process administrative paperwork in accordance to departmental policies and procedures.
  • Actively functions as a team member.
  • Demonstrates commitment to quality of service.
  • Complies with Able Engineering Services and facility policies and procedures.
  • Complies and participates with Able Engineering Services safety program.
  • Complies and participates in facility specific safety program.
  • Maintains regular attendance in the workplace.
  • Provides highest quality of service to the tenants, staff and visitors at the facility.
  • Participates in regular required communication with Chief Engineer, Assistant Chief Engineer, management, tenants and other staff.
SKILLS / EDUCATION / EXPERIENCE:
  • Must have a New Jersey Black Seal license.
  • Experience that is commensurate with the specific facility for the position of HVAC Mechanic
  • Computer skills at a level to interact with building and ABM Engineering Services' computerized systems in place.
  • Certification meeting OSHA ACM awareness training requirements as required.
  • Working knowledge of energy conservation strategies (energy saving lighting, etc.).
